Ingredients List

To create this festive treat, you’ll need the following ingredients:

  • Popcorn Kernels (1 cup): Use high-quality kernels for the best popping results. Alternatively, you can use pre-popped popcorn for convenience.
  • Green Candy Melts (2 cups): These will give your popcorn that signature Grinch green color. If you can’t find green candy melts, white chocolate can be dyed with green food coloring.
  • Salt (1 teaspoon): Enhances the overall flavor. Sea salt or Himalayan pink salt works well for a gourmet touch.
  • Mini Marshmallows (1 cup): These add a chewy texture and sweetness. You can substitute with vegan marshmallows for a plant-based option.
  • Red Sprinkles (for decoration): These add a festive touch. Try using edible glitter or crushed red candies for a twist.

Step-by-Step Instructions

Step 1: Pop the Popcorn

  1. Pop the Kernels: If using unpopped kernels, follow the instructions on your popcorn maker or stovetop method. Aim for about 8 cups of popped popcorn.
    • Tip: For extra flavor, consider adding a tablespoon of coconut oil to the popping process.

Step 2: Melt the Candy

  1. Melt the Green Candy Melts: In a microwave-safe bowl, heat the green candy melts in 30-second intervals, stirring in between until completely melted and smooth.
    • Tip: Be careful not to overheat, as this can cause the chocolate to seize.

Step 3: Coat the Popcorn

  1. Combine Popcorn and Chocolate: In a large mixing bowl, pour the popped popcorn and drizzle the melted green candy over it. Gently stir to coat all the popcorn evenly.
    • Tip: Use a spatula to avoid crushing the popcorn.

Step 4: Add Marshmallows and Sprinkles

  1. Mix in the Marshmallows: Fold in the mini marshmallows until evenly distributed.
  2. Sprinkle with Red Decorations: Finally, add your red sprinkles for a festive touch.
    • Tip: For a gourmet look, consider adding crushed peppermint candies.

Step 5: Set and Serve

  1. Let It Set: Spread the popcorn mixture onto a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Allow it to cool and harden for about 10 minutes.
  2. Serve: Once set, break into pieces and serve in festive bowls or bags.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

To ensure your Easy Grinch Popcorn turns out perfectly, keep these common pitfalls in mind:

  • Overheating the Chocolate: This can lead to a grainy texture. Always melt in short intervals.
  • Using Old Popcorn: Stale kernels won’t pop well. Fresh kernels yield the best results.
  • Not Coating Evenly: Make sure to mix thoroughly to avoid clumps of uncoated popcorn.

Storing Tips for the Recipe

To keep your Easy Grinch Popcorn fresh and delicious, follow these storage tips:

  • Airtight Container: Store in an airtight container at room temperature. It will stay fresh for up to a week.
  • Avoid Refrigeration: Storing in the fridge can make the popcorn soggy.
  • Freezing: If you want to prepare in advance, you can freeze the popcorn in a sealed bag for up to a month. Just let it thaw at room temperature before serving.

FAQs

Q1: Can I make this popcorn in advance?

A1: Yes, you can make it a day ahead of time. Just store it in an airtight container to maintain freshness.

Q2: Is there a vegan version of this recipe?

A2: Absolutely! Use vegan marshmallows and substitute candy melts with dairy-free chocolate.

Q3: What can I use instead of candy melts?

A3: You can melt white chocolate and add green food coloring for a similar effect.

Q4: How do I make this treat less sweet?

A4: Reduce the amount of candy melts used and increase the popcorn ratio for a more balanced flavor.

Q5: Can I add nuts or other toppings?

A5: Yes! Feel free to add chopped nuts, dried fruits, or even crushed cookies for added texture and flavor.
